Frequently Asked Questions

How can I find a reputable travel agent specializing in Gulf Coast vacations in Long Beach, MS?

Start by checking with the Long Beach Chamber of Commerce for local recommendations, or search for agents affiliated with national networks like ASTA who list Gulf Coast expertise. Many agents in the area have strong partnerships with nearby casinos, beach resorts, and charter fishing companies, offering specialized knowledge of the Mississippi Sound and barrier islands.

What unique local travel experiences can a Long Beach, MS agent help me book?

A local agent can arrange experiences like private charters to Ship Island for day trips, guided eco-tours of the Gulf Islands National Seashore, or packages combining stays at beachfront condos with dining at iconic spots like The Chimneys. They often have insider access to seasonal events like the Long Beach Mardi Gras Parade or fishing tournaments.

Are there travel agents in Long Beach who focus on group or family reunions for beach destinations?

Yes, several agents in the area specialize in coordinating large family or group vacations along the Mississippi Gulf Coast. They can help secure blocks of rooms at beachfront properties, arrange catering for gatherings, and organize activities like dolphin cruises or kayak rentals that appeal to all ages, leveraging local vendor relationships for better rates.

What should I expect in terms of fees when using a travel agent in Long Beach, Mississippi?

Many Long Beach agents earn commissions from suppliers, so you may not pay direct fees for standard bookings like flights or hotels. However, for custom itineraries or complex trips, some charge planning fees ranging from $50-$200, often waived if you book through them. Always ask about their fee structure upfront, as it varies by agency.

Can a Long Beach travel agent assist with last-minute getaways to nearby destinations like New Orleans or Florida?

Absolutely. Local agents often have access to last-minute deals on regional travel, such as short drives to Biloxi casinos, quick flights from Gulfport-Biloxi International Airport, or road trips to New Orleans. Their connections with regional tour operators and hotels can help secure value-packed spontaneous trips, especially during off-peak seasons.

Navigating Corporate Travel to Long Beach, Mississippi: Why the Right Booking Partner Matters

Planning corporate travel to Long Beach, Mississippi, presents a unique set of opportunities and logistical considerations. While this charming Gulf Coast community is renowned for its relaxed atmosphere and beautiful beaches, business travelers need efficient, reliable arrangements that maximize productivity and comfort. This is where partnering with a specialized corporate travel booking company becomes invaluable, especially for a destination that blends business with a distinct coastal culture.

A corporate travel agency familiar with the Mississippi Gulf Coast understands that your trip to Long Beach isn't just about a hotel and a flight. They recognize the importance of proximity to key business hubs like the Stennis Space Center or the Port of Gulfport, while also considering the post-meeting environment. The right agency can secure accommodations that offer both reliable high-speed internet for virtual meetings and easy access to the serene shoreline for strategic networking walks. They handle the complexities of regional travel, such as coordinating ground transportation from Gulfport-Biloxi International Airport (GPT) or navigating the seasonal flux in availability during popular local festivals.

For companies sending teams to Long Beach for extended projects, conferences, or client engagements, a dedicated booking partner provides consistency and duty of care. They can establish preferred rates at hotels that cater to business needs, like the Hilton Garden Inn Gulfport/Biloxi or local boutique options with meeting spaces, ensuring your team has a productive base. Furthermore, they manage the details that individuals often overlook—travel insurance policies that cover Gulf Coast weather contingencies, streamlined expense reporting, and 24/7 support if a flight is cancelled into GPT. This administrative lift allows your employees to focus on the business objectives at hand, not the logistics.

Perhaps most importantly, a corporate travel company with regional insight adds tangible value. They can advise on the most efficient rental car options for navigating between Long Beach, Biloxi, and Gulfport, or recommend reputable local dining venues suitable for client entertainment. They understand the rhythm of the coast, helping to avoid scheduling conflicts with major events like Cruisin' the Coast that can affect traffic and hotel pricing. This localized knowledge transforms a simple booking service into a strategic travel management partner.
